On Thu, Dec 28, 2017 at 10:06 AM, Jakub Jelinek <jakub@redhat.com> wrote:
> Hi!
>
> I've noticed various formatting issues in the recently added ISA support
> patterns. No functional changes, bootstrapped/regtested on x86_64-linux and
> i686-linux, ok for trunk?
>
> OT, wonder why we have any of the maskz and maskz_1 patterns, can't it be
> done in the intrinsic header by using the mask intrinsic with a _mm*zero*
> operand? I understand the need to have separate builtins for masked and
> non-masked at least in some cases (as we need AVX512BW for the masked cases
> but not for unmasked).
